The Abia State leader of the All Progressives Grand Alliance and representative of Aba South Constituency in the Abia State House of Assembly, Hon Obinna Ichita, has lauded the defection of the Senate Minority Leader, Senator Enyinnaya Abaribe, to his party.
Senator Abaribe had on Friday announced his resignation from the Peoples Democratic Party and joining of APGA.
The representative of Abia South Senatorial District confirmed the development in a statement made available to journalists in Aba.
Abaribe further disclosed that he would be participating in the party’s senatorial primaries on Saturday (today).
Earlier also, Senator Abaribe had equally resigned as the Minority Leader in the upper chamber of the National Assembly.
Reacting shortly after a visit to the ex-Minority Leader of the Senate in a statement issued in Umuahia on Friday night, Ichita appealed to all progressives to join APGA so as to collectively salvage Abia State from the clutches of bad governance.
The Abia State opposition leader also urged eligible citizens living in the state to register and obtain their Permanent Voter Cards to enable them enthrone responsive and purposeful leaderships at all levels of the state.
He stated: “While we welcome the distinguished Senator to APGA, I appeal to all Progressives to join APGA so that collectively, we can save Abia from the clutches of bad governance. I also appeal to everyone living in Abia State to please register and obtain their Permanent Voter Cards (PVC).
“Five days ago, the leadership of All Progressives Grand Alliance (APGA) in Abia State visited Distinguished Senator Enyinnaya Abaribe and urged him to join the revolution to redeem Abia State from the clutches of administrative ineptitude. The Senator promised to consult his constituents before considering our proposal.
“Today, Distinguished Senator Enyinnaya Abaribe, having consulted with his constituents, has joined APGA and will be running to return to the Senate. Senator Abaribe has resigned his position as the Minority Leader of the Nigerian Senate. He has also resigned his membership of the PDP.
